Tucked away in Bukit Mertajam, Pick A Brew is one of those cafes that truly surprises you, in the best way. Whether you're looking for a spot to get some work done, enjoy a good cup of coffee, or just take a quiet moment for yourself, this cafe delivers on all fronts.
🌟 Ambience
The moment you walk in, you're greeted by calming aesthetics and a warm, inviting atmosphere. It’s not flashy or overly done; just the right balance of minimalism and charm. The seating is comfortable, and the layout is well-thought-out for both solo visitors and small groups. Despite being cozy, it doesn’t feel cramped; in fact, it’s quite the perfect quiet escape from the busier streets outside.
☕ Coffee & Menu
Their coffee game is solid. Whether you're into espresso-based drinks or more experimental brews, you’ll find something you enjoy. I had a cup of their signature house blend, and it was smooth, balanced, and thoughtfully made. For non-coffee drinkers, their matcha and teas are a solid alternative.
The menu has a decent selection of light bites and desserts, not an extensive food menu, but what they offer is curated and well-prepared. Great if you're not looking for a heavy meal but want something to pair with your drink.
💻 Work-Friendly Setup
One of the best things about Pick A Brew is how conducive it is for working or reading. There are ample plug points, stable Wi-Fi, and just enough soft background music to set the mood without being distracting. You’ll spot a good mix of remote workers, students, and casual coffee lovers throughout the day.
🚻 Facilities & Service
A rare but appreciated mention: their toilets are clean and well-maintained, which is honestly something that makes a big difference for regular café-goers.
The staff are incredibly friendly and genuine, always ready with a smile and helpful recommendations. You can tell they care about creating a good experience for their customers.
✅ Overall Verdict: Pick A Brew is the kind of place that earns your loyalty without needing to shout for attention. It's understated, thoughtful, and dependable, a hidden gem for anyone in the Bukit Mertajam area. Whether you're there for a productive day out or just to enjoy some me-time with a hot drink, this café won’t disappoint.

Considered a quiet cafe in noon. Enjoyed working there in the cozy environment, the coffee and Tiramisu with Liquor is good. Staffs are nice 😊. Yet to try their food (will update next time).
Got to know that there are sports centre upstairs at 2F and 3F (badminton, pingpong, muaythai..).
So kindly note that limited parking during evening time as all sports are running but definitely able to find the parking in noon...
